Why are your recordings expensive?

Occasionally people ask us why our recordings are so expensive. Some point out that free binaural beats are available on YouTube or tell us about free Apps that can customize binaural beats to the listener's preferences.

Others suggest our recordings cost a lot more than regular music or that spiritually-related teachings should be made available at no or low cost. Here is how we typically answer those questions in case others are wondering the same things.

YouTube currently limits the quality of their audio recordings to 192kbps. In our experience, this level of quality does not deliver the full benefit of binaural beat recordings. Depending on the producer, there may be some level of effect, but in general, these recordings will not be as powerful. It may be an easy way to find ambient music for background, but likely not provide an adequate soundscape for a deep sound journey into consciousness.

Apps that allow the user to select custom binaural beats with the option for different audio backgrounds (such as rain or surf) certainly have some appeal. In this case, the audio quality may be there, but compared to our multi-layered harmonic compositions, these sounds will be simple. This approach may work well for some situations or listeners, but not as well for others. 

In general, the value of our recordings relates to the level of complexity involved in their creation. Over years of trial and error, we developed a proprietary method of combining binaural beats with monaural beats, a process we call NeuralHelix®.

All of our recordings contain NeuralHelix along with other sound effects that are selected based on their precise harmonic relationships to all other frequencies. A process of trial and error ensures the highest effectiveness for the desired purpose.

Unlike typical music, each of our recordings takes months to develop and we create a unique combination of frequencies each time, rarely repurposing the same formulas except when explicitly stated (for example, our Om frequencies that start off multiple recordings).

Brainwave entrainment audio technology generally costs more than regular music but among the many producers, our prices are at the lower end of the spectrum.
